Development of durable oil-repellent paint for food processing and compliance with safety standards

目次
Introduction to Oil-Repellent Paint in Food Processing
The food processing industry is constantly evolving, demanding innovations to enhance productivity and maintain safety standards.
One such innovation is the development of durable oil-repellent paint.
This paint plays a crucial role in maintaining hygiene and safety in environments where oil and grease are prevalent.
In this article, we will explore the development of oil-repellent paints tailored specifically for food processing and how these coatings comply with stringent safety standards.
Why Oil-Repellent Paint Is Important
In food processing facilities, oil and grease can pose a significant challenge.
They not only make surfaces slippery and hazardous but can also contribute to contamination.
Oil-repellent paint acts as a barrier, preventing oil and grease from adhering to surfaces.
This reduces the risk of slips and falls while promoting a cleaner, safer environment.
Moreover, these paints help facilities comply with health and safety regulations by minimizing contamination risks.
A cleaner environment directly contributes to the quality and safety of food products, which is paramount in this industry.
Properties of Durable Oil-Repellent Paint
Developing a paint that is durable and oil-repellent involves creating a formulation that can withstand rigorous conditions typical in food processing environments.
Here are some essential properties of these paints:
Hydrophobic and Oleophobic Characteristics
Oil-repellent paints possess both hydrophobic (water-repellent) and oleophobic (oil-repellent) properties.
This means they repel both water and oil-based substances, reducing the likelihood of stains and contamination.
High Durability
Durability is critical as food processing areas undergo constant cleaning and are exposed to harsh chemicals.
The paint must withstand regular cleaning routines without losing its repellent qualities or breaking down.
Temperature Resistance
Food processing environments often experience extreme temperatures, either from machinery or the food itself.
The paint must resist these temperature changes without peeling or cracking.
Non-Toxic and Food Safe
Since these coatings are used where food is processed, they must be non-toxic.
The paints must be free of harmful substances that could leach and contaminate food products.
Development Process of Oil-Repellent Paint
The development of oil-repellent paint involves a meticulous process combining scientific research and practical considerations.
Research and Innovation
Research is at the core of developing these coatings.
Scientists work to discover new materials and methods to enhance oil-repellent properties while ensuring safety and durability.
Innovations in nanotechnology often play a crucial role, where tiny particles are used to create smooth, repellent surfaces.
Testing and Quality Control
Once a formulation is developed, rigorous testing is essential to ensure durability and effectiveness.
These tests include exposure to oil, chemicals, and varying temperatures.
Quality control ensures that each batch of paint meets the same stringent standards, providing consistency and reliability.
Compliance with Safety Standards
Oil-repellent paints must comply with national and international safety standards to be used in food processing.
Standards such as the Food and Drug Administration (FDA) in the United States or the European Food Safety Authority (EFSA) in Europe dictate the criteria that these products must meet.
This ensures that they are safe for use in environments where food is handled and processed.
Meeting Safety Standards
Ensuring that oil-repellent paints meet or exceed safety standards is critical for protecting both consumers and workers in the food processing industry.
Regular Audits and Certifications
Facilities utilizing these paints should undergo regular audits to ensure compliance with safety standards.
Certifications from recognized bodies assure stakeholders that the paint used is up to the required safety standards.
Training and Implementation
Proper training must be provided to those applying the paint to ensure correct implementation.
They should understand the safety protocols and application techniques to maintain compliance with safety standards.
Monitoring and Maintenance
Once applied, regular monitoring and maintenance of painted surfaces help sustain their effectiveness.
This includes routine inspections to check for wear and reapplication if necessary.
